Illinois AG Raoul Joins Multistate Lawsuit Against USPS

By Greg Halbleib Aug 27, 2026 | 5:38 AM

Illinois is suing the Postal Service to block it from interfering in the upcoming midterm elections.

Capitol News Illinois reports Attorney General Kwame Raoul has joined a multistate lawsuit that seeks to block the Postal Service from enforcing new rules that seek to restrict who is allowed to cast mail-in ballots.

Those rules stem from a March 31 st executive order by President Donald Trump that he says is aimed at preventing non-citizens from casting ballots.

The lawsuit was filed Wednesday in federal court in Massachusetts.

It follows a U.S. Supreme Court ruling Monday that temporarily allows the Trump administration to proceed with implementing that executive order while a separate legal challenge is pending.
